Window remodeling services involve updating or replacing existing windows to enhance a property's app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ency. This process may include installing new window frames, upgrading glass panes, or replacing entire window units to match the property's style and needs. Contractors specializing in window remodeling can help improve the overall aesthetic of a home or commercial building while ensuring the installation meets structural and safety standards.
One of the primary benefits of window remodeling is addressing issues related to energy loss and drafts. Older or poorly installed windows can lead to increased heating and cooling costs, as they may not provide adequate insulation. Additionally, window remodeling can help eliminate problems such as difficulty opening or closing windows, condensation build-up, or drafts that compromise comfort. By upgrading to modern, well-designed windows, property owners can achieve better insulation, reduce utility bills, and improve indoor comfort.

The overview below groups typical Window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Plymouth County,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Window Replacement Costs - Replacing wind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, style, and materials. For example, standard double-pane windows in Plymouth County might cost around $500 each installed.
Frame Material Expenses - The choice of frame material impacts costs, with vinyl frames averaging $100 to $300 per window, while wood or fiberglass frames can range from $400 to $900 each. Material selection influences both initial investment and long-term maintenance.
Labor and Installation Fees - Installation costs generally fall between $150 and $500 per window, varying by contractor, window size, and complexity of the project. Proper installation is essential for energy efficiency and durability.
Additional Costs and Upgrades - Upgrading to energy-efficient or custom-designed windows can add $200 to $600 per window. These enhancements may include special coatings or decorative features, affecting overall project expenses.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
